Hey everyone. I have read a lot of posts, and I have to say I disagree as to the interpriation of the following stanza::

"To call for hands of above
To lean on
Wouldn't be good enough
For me, no"

I believe is an indication that the singer is calling for the comfort of God. "to lean on" can be equated to "for support". However, the singer does not believe the mental comfort one would get from such an act (such as prayer or even faith) is "good enough" -- not after he the intense physical love he had shared.
